源代码仓库
捐赠
0. 序言
1. 开发相关概念
1.1. Forge的历史
1.2. 混淆与反混淆
1.3. 客户端与服务端
1.4. 事件系统初步
2. 工作环境搭建
3. 正式开始-初级部分
3.1. 主类与Mod信息
3.2. 物品
3.2.1. 创建简单物品
3.2.2. 物品的模型与材质
3.2.3. 工具、武器、护甲与食物
3.2.4. 创造模式物品栏
3.2.5. ItemStack
3.2.6. 更复杂的物品
3.3. 方块
3.3.1. 创建简单方块
3.3.2. 方块的模型与材质
3.3.3. 多BlockState方块
3.3.4. 方块碰撞箱与半透明材质
3.4. 实例注册问题详解
3.5. 语言文件与本地化
3.6. 合成表与熔炉配方
3.7. 更新Forge与Mappings
4. 逐渐深入-中级部分
4.1. 图形界面
4.1.1. GUI
4.1.2. Container
4.1.3. HUD
4.2. 成就/进度
4.3. 数据包相关
4.3.1. 成就/进度
4.3.2. Tag
4.4. 流体
4.5. 世界生成
4.5.1. 矿物生成
4.5.2. 树木生成
4.5.3. 结构生成
4.5.4. 生物群系
4.5.5. 世界类型
4.5.6. 维度与区块生成器、生物群系提供器
4.6. 实体
4.6.1. 动物实体
4.6.2. 实体的渲染
4.6.3. AI
4.6.4. 实体数据同步
4.6.5. 投掷物
Published with GitBook
1. 开发相关概念
开发相关概念
在开始之前,我们要先了解Mod开发的一些概念。例如Forge的历史,一些处理机制等,这些有助于我们日后的开发。
results matching "
"
No results matching "
"